Property Description

An extraordinary opportunity to live directly on Central Park, with over 2,000 sq ft of living space, where breathtaking, unobstructed views become the backdrop to your everyday life. This distinguished residence, set within the iconic 1929 Rosario Candela-designed building, has been masterfully reimagined by CetraRuddy Architects-seamlessly blending historic grandeur with modern refinement .

Bathed in natural light, the expansive great room showcases coffered ceilings, 5-inch solid oak flooring and landmark-approved double-pane Pella windows that frame stunning park vistas. The gourmet kitchen is a masterpiece of both form and function, featuring exquisite Calacatta Caldia marble countertops, state-of-the-art Miele appliances, a Bertazzoni range crowned by a handcrafted Italian copper hood, and custom cabinetry with inset lighting .

Down the hallways that make this condo feel like a home, you'll find a corner primary bedroom offering double exposure, with both park and southern views, and massive walk-in closet with built-ins. A sanctuary of sophistication, the primary ensuite bath is adorned with floor-to-ceiling Bianco Namibia marble, luxurious heated floors, and elegant Waterworks fixtures . Down the hall, a 2nd larger bedroom offers southern exposure, large walk-in closet, and ensuite bathrooms with heated floors and luxurious bathroom fixtures. A versatile additional 3rd room offers endless possibilities- a 3rd bedroom, home office, formal dining room, or library, all with a front-row seat to the splendor of Central Park . Final finishes include multiple walk-in closets throughout the home, washer dryer, and central air.

360 Central Park West is a park-facing condominium on the Upper West Side. Residents enjoy an array of premier amenities, including full-time concierge services, a fitness center, and a charming children's playroom. This pet-friendly building offers unparalleled access to the very best of New York City-just outside your door, discover Central Park's tennis courts, playgrounds, scenic trails, live performances, theaters, and world-class museums .
